Palmer's elm-leaf goldenrod

Solidago ulmifolia var. palmeri

Palmer's elm-leaf goldenrod (Solidago ulmifolia var. palmeri) is a perennial in the — family. Native range includes AR, KS, MO, OK. Hardy in zones 5a–9a. Mature size 6"–4'. Blooms Aug–Oct.

In the same native range, palmer's elm-leaf goldenrod pairs naturally with: Broadleaf Arrowhead (Sagittaria latifolia), Butterfly Milkweed (Asclepias tuberosa), Cardinal Flower (Lobelia cardinalis), Common Blue Violet (Viola sororia).
